Method 1 Checking the Dog's Physical Features Download Article 1 Check the size of the canine. Size is an easy way to tell if your dog is an Alaskan Malamute or a Siberian Husky. See if the dog is large or medium-sized. Alaskan Malamutes are larger than Siberian Huskies. They are usually about 22-27.5 inches (56-70 cm) [1] and are considered large.

Malamute History Like the Husky, the Malamute is also one of the most ancient dog breeds out there. Although the dog breed hails from Alaska, the dog's ancestors reached North America from Siberia by crossing the Bering Strait. While the Malamute shares a noticeable resemblance with the Husky, it was originally bred for hauling heavy sleds.

The Alusky is not a purebred dog. It is a cross between the Alaskan Malamute and the Siberian Husky. The best way to determine the temperament of a mixed breed is to look up all breeds in the cross and know you can get any combination of any of the characteristics found in either breed. Not all of these designer hybrid dogs being bred are 50%.
